Do’s And Don’ts In Case Of Water Damage
Water gives life, however water intrusion on some components where it's not intended to be can result in damage as well as trouble. In enhancement, houses with water damage smell old as well as moldy.

Water can come from many sources like hurricanes, floods, ruptured pipes, leakages, as well as sewer concerns. If you have water damages, it's better to have a working knowledge of security preventative measures. Below are a few guidelines on just how to deal with water damage.

Do Prioritize House Insurance Coverage Insurance Coverage



Seasonal water damage can come from floods, seasonal rainfalls, and also wind. There is also an occurrence of an unexpected flooding, whether it originated from a faulty pipe that unexpectedly breaks into your house. To shield your residence, get home insurance coverage that covers both acts of God such as all-natural tragedies, and also emergencies like broken plumbing.

Don't Forget to Switch Off Utilities



When disaster strikes and you're in a flood-prone area, shut off the primary electric circuit. Switching off the power protects against
electric shocks when water can be found in as water serves as a conductor. Do not neglect to switch off the primary water line shutoff as a method to avoid more damage.
If the floodwaters are getting high, keep your furniture stable as they can move around and trigger extra damage.

Do Remain Proactive and Heed Climate Informs



Tornado floods can be very unpredictable. Remain positive and prepared at all times if you live in an area tormented by floodings. If you live near a body of water like a river, creek, or lake , listen to the information as well as evacuation cautions. Secure your belongings and vital files from the ground floor and also cellar, then placed them in a refuge and the greatest possible degree.

Do Not Overlook the Roof



Your roofing contractor needs to take care of the faulty rain gutters or any kind of various other signs of damage or weakening. An evaluation will certainly protect against water from moving down your walls and soaking your ceiling.

Do Take Notice Of Small Leaks



There are red flags that can draw your focus and also show to you some damaged pipelines in your house. Signs of red flags in your pipes consist of gurgling paint, peeling wallpaper, water streaks, water stains, or leaking noises behind the walls. Repair and also evaluate your plumbing fixed before it results in huge damage to your residence, financial resources, as well as a personal problem.

Do Not Panic in Case of a Ruptured Pipeline



Timing is vital when it comes to water damage. If a pipeline ruptureds in your house, quickly shut off your primary water shutoff to cut off the resource and also avoid even more damages. Call a reliable water damages reconstruction specialist for support.

Water Damage Do and Don'ts


Water damage at your home or commercial property is a serious problem. You will need assistance from a professional plumber and a water damage restoration agency to get things back in order. While you are waiting for help to arrive, however, there are some things you should do to make the situation better. Likewise, there are things you absolutely shoud not do because they will only make things worse.




DO these things to improve your situation


Get some ventilation going. Open up your doors, your windows, your cabinets – everything. Don’t let anything remain closed. Your aim here is to expose as much surface area to air as possible in order to quicken the drying out process. Use fans if you have them, but only if they’re plugged into a part of the house that’s not currently underwater.


Remove as much standing water as you can. Do this by using mops, sponges and clean white towels. However, it’s important that you don’t push or wipe the water. Simply use blotting motions to soak it up. Wiping or pushing could result in the water getting pushed deeper into your home or carpeting and increasing your problem.


Turn off the power to the soaked areas. You will want to remove the danger of electrocution from the water-logged area to do some cleaning and to help the plumber and the restoration agents do their work.



Move any furniture and belongings from the affected room to a safe and dry area. Taking your possessions to a dry place will make it easier to decide which need restoring and repair. It will also prevent your belongings from being exposed to further moisture.


DON’T do any of these things for any reason


Don’t use your vacuum cleaner to suck up the water. This will not only get you electrocuted, but will also severely damage your vacuum cleaner. Use manual means of water removal, like with mops and pails.



Don’t use newspaper to soak up the water. The ink they use for newsprint runs and transfers very easily, which could then stain carpet and tile with hard-to-remove stains.



Don’t disturb mold. This is especially true if you spot a severe growth. Leave the mold remediation efforts to the professionals. Attempting to clean it yourself could mean exposing yourself to the harmful health effects of mold. Worse, you could inadvertently spread it to other areas of the house.



Don’t turn on your HVAC system until given approval from the restoration agency. Turning your HVAC system on before everything has been cleaned could spread moisture and mold all over the house.
